AstroTurf® Great Lakes Achieves Over Sixty Installations in 2025

AstroTurf® Great Lakes: A Transformative Year in 2025



In 2025, AstroTurf® Great Lakes has marked a significant milestone by surpassing over sixty field installations across Michigan and neighboring regions. This achievement positions the distributor as one of the rapidly expanding leaders in the synthetic turf industry. From various community sports complexes to significant collegiate athletic venues like the University of Michigan, AstroTurf Great Lakes is pioneering a change that enhances athletic experiences for players and communities alike.

With over sixty successful installations attributed to this landmark year, AstroTurf Great Lakes is setting a precedence for growth within the AstroTurf network, impacting athletic communities throughout Michigan and the Midwest. The company serves as the sole distributor of AstroTurf products across several states, including Michigan, Wisconsin, Minnesota, and Illinois.

For over six decades, AstroTurf has pioneered innovations in synthetic turf, creating solutions for professional stadiums, educational institutions, and community fields alike. Key technologies, such as RootZone® and Trionic® fibers, have been developed with an emphasis on safety and sustainability, reinforcing AstroTurf's commitment to meeting the high expectations of athletic field owners and users. The company’s initiatives, including USDA BioPreferred® certification, reflect a holistic approach to environmental responsibility, ensuring that each field installation contributes positively to its ecosystem.
